Use "punitive" in a sentence | "punitive" example sentences

How to use "punitive" in a sentence?

  • God was treated like this powerful, erratic, rather punitive father who has to be pacified and praised. You know, flattered.
    -John Cleese-
  • Job creation requires a business friendly environment with a tax structure that is not punitive and a state government designed for efficient use of fewer tax dollars.
    -Ken Blackwell-
  • The punitive use of force tends to generate hostility and to reinforce resistance to the very behavior we are seeking.
    -Marshall B. Rosenberg-
  • Those jobs flee other states because of factors like excessive taxation, punitive regulation and frivolous lawsuits.
    -Rick Perry-
  • I don't want to pass a punitive law, or use politics as a vendetta.
    -Romano Prodi-
  • Do we need recourse to a happier state before the law in order to maintain that contemporary gender relations and the punitive production of gender identities are oppressive?
    -Judith Butler-
  • America is a nation fundamentally ambivalent about its children, often afraid of its children, and frequently punitive toward its children.
    -Letty Cottin Pogrebin-
  • Cottage cheese is one of our culture's most visible symbols of self-denial; marketed honestly, it would appear in dairy cases with warning labels: this substance is self-punitive; ingest with caution.
    -Caroline Knapp-

Definition and meaning of PUNITIVE

What does "punitive mean?"

/ˈpyo͞onədiv/

punitive

adjective
Intended to punish; severe; harsh.

What are synonyms of "punitive"?
Some common synonyms of "punitive" are:
  • penal,
  • disciplinary,
  • corrective,
  • correctional,
  • retributive,
  • penitentiary,
  • punitory,
  • castigatory,

/ˈpēn(ə)l/

penal
adjective

Concerning punishment or penalties for crimes.

disciplinary
adjective

Concerning discipline in behavior.

/kəˈrektiv/

corrective
adjective noun

Designed to promote discipline. thing intended to correct or counteract something else.

/kəˈrekSH(ə)n(ə)l/

correctional
adjective

Concerned with or providing correction.

retributive
adjective

Involving punishment/reaction due to past actions.

/ˌpenəˈten(t)SH(ə)rē/

penitentiary
adjective noun

Prison for those convicted of major crimes. prison for people convicted of serious crimes.
